It Can Boost Your Home’s Energy Efficiency

The right siding material can boost your home’s energy efficiency and help you save on utility costs. This component pays as a barrier that insulates your home against outside temperatures. With energy-efficient siding, your HVAC system won’t need to work as hard. As a result, you will enjoy savings on your monthly energy costs.  

Quality siding will shade your home and deflect solar heat instead of absorbing it. It Prevents Water From Infiltrating Your Home

Your siding keeps rainwater from entering your home. If your siding is in bad shape, it can create numerous problems in your interior. It can lead to rot, pests and mold and mildew growth. When moisture rots the studs and frames supporting your home, you could face major structural damage. To avoid these problems, make sure to invest in quality siding and maintain it regularly.
